DuBOIS -- Hollidaysburg's goal going into Friday night's game against DuBois at E.J. Mansell Stadium was to win and finish the regular season with a 9-1 record for the third time in program history.
The Golden Tigers accomplished that mission on a beautiful night.
Quarterback Maddox Bainey threw for 216 yards and three touchdowns and ran for another while Mitchell Baronner ran for 161 yards and two touchdowns en route to a 49-28 win.
"It's a great season for us so far," Hollidaysburg coach Homer DeLattre said. "We have high goals. We have a home game (against Allderdice) in the postseason, and then we have a very tough subregional with DuBois or Cathedral Prep.
"These guys took their lumps. They were 2-8 as sophomores, with most of them playing as sophomores quite a bit. Last year, we were 5-6. They kept playing hard, kept believing in each other, kept working hard and believing in the coaches. They were rewarded with a great season."
The Golden Tigers kept the Beavers' passing game in check. DuBois quarterback Trey Wingard completed 26 of 41 passes for only 195 yards, or 7.5 yards per pass, two touchdowns and one interception. He also ran for a touchdown. DuBois had 75 total plays for 363 yards.
"They had a good game plan," DeLattre said. "They have some really talented receivers. Our defense was a bend-but-not-break defense in a couple situations. The two turnovers were really critical."
Play of the game: After DuBois used 12 plays to go 55 yards and scored on a Wingard 1-yard sneak on fourth down in the first quarter, Bainey connected with Cole DeLattre for an 80-yard touchdown pass on the first play of the ensuing series.
"It was a really big momentum shifter early in the game," Bainey said.
Player of the game: Bainey completed 8 of his 14 passes and connected on 4 of 5 passes in the second half. Bainey threw a 14-yard TD pass to Brady Steiner. He also ran for 21 yards on 10 carries and scored on a 2-yard run.
"Maddox played well," Coach DeLattre said. "He was able to make some plays with his feet as well. We mixed the quarterback run in."
"It went well," Bainey said. "Having a good running game allowed us to open up in the passing game."
Big first half: Baronner ran for 151 of his 161 yards in the first half on only 10 carries, including a 59-yard touchdown run. He also had a 10-yard TD run.
"He ran well," DeLattre said. "They gave us a light box, just a five-man front. They were playing an umbrella over top. He made some nice cuts and the line got some good push. He's been running hard all year long, and he's deserving of a big night."
Unsung heroes: The Hollidaysburg offensive line opened up holes and protected Bainey.
Homer DeLattre on the game: "That was a great game. They have some really good players and a great offense. We got the benefit of a fumble and we made a nice play in the red zone. Those two plays really changed the game for us."
Next week: Hollidaysburg hosts Allderdice in a Class 5A subregional game. DuBois visits Cathedral Prep in the subregional.
Records: Hollidaysburg (9-1), DuBois (7-3).
